Immigrants from Fiji vs Mexican American Indian 6th Grade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 93,756,204 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Fiji and percentage of population with at least 6th grade education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.278 and weighted average of 95.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 317,621,104 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Mexican American Indians and percentage of population with at least 6th grade education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.285 and weighted average of 95.0%, a difference of 0.22%.
